Board of Censors.
1916, ch. 209, see. 3.
3. The Board shall consist of three residents and citizens of the
State of Maryland, one of whom shall be a member of the political
party polling the second highest vote at the last general election prior
to their appointment, well qualified by education and experience to act
as censors under this Article. One member of the Board shall be Chair-
man, one member shall be Vice-Chairman and one member shall be Sec-
retary. They shall be appointed by the Governor, by and with the
advice and consent of the Senate, for terms of three years. Those first
appointed under this Article shall be appointed for three years, two
years and one year, respectively; the respective terms to be designated
by the Governor.
1916, ch. 209, sec. 4.
4. A vacancy in the membership of the Board shall be filled for the
unexpired term by the Governor.' A vacancy shall not impair the right
and duty of the remaining members to perform all the functions of the
Board.
Seal.
1916, ch. 209, sec. 5.
5. The Board shall procure and use an official seal, which shall con-
tain the words, "Maryland State Board of Censors," together with such
design engraved thereon as the Board may prescribe.
Approvals by Board.
1916, ch. 209, sec. 6.
6. The Board shall examine or supervise the examinations of all
films, reels or views to be exhibited or used in the State of Maryland
and shall approve such films, reels or views which are moral and proper,
and shall disapprove such as are sacrilegious, obscene, indecent, or im-
moral, or such as tend, in the judgment of the Board, to debase or cor-
rupt morals.
